
如果忘记了Excel的PIN密码,可以尝试以下方法:使用密码恢复工具、尝试旧密码、联系IT支持、使用备份文件、重置工作表密码。这些方法可以帮助你恢复对文件的访问。
使用密码恢复工具是一个常见且有效的解决方案。在市面上有许多专业的软件可以帮助你恢复或移除Excel文件的密码。通常,这些工具会利用不同的算法来破解密码,过程可能需要一些时间,但成功率通常较高。以下是对使用密码恢复工具的详细描述。
密码恢复工具通常分为两种类型:一种是通过暴力破解法尝试所有可能的组合,另一种是通过字典攻击法使用常见的密码列表进行匹配。暴力破解法需要较长时间,尤其是当密码复杂时;而字典攻击法则相对快一些,但前提是密码在常用列表中。选择合适的工具并根据自己的需要进行配置,可以大大提高恢复密码的效率。
一、使用密码恢复工具
密码恢复工具是一种专门设计用于破解和恢复各种类型文件密码的软件。这些工具可以通过多种方法,如暴力破解、字典攻击和掩码攻击等,来尝试找到丢失的密码。以下是一些流行的密码恢复工具及其使用方法:
1.1 暴力破解法
暴力破解法尝试所有可能的密码组合,直到找到正确的密码。这种方法对简单密码有效,但对复杂密码可能需要较长时间。
- 下载并安装密码恢复工具,例如PassFab for Excel。
- 运行软件并导入受保护的Excel文件。
- 选择“暴力破解”选项。
- 开始破解过程,等待软件找到密码。
1.2 字典攻击法
字典攻击法使用常见密码列表进行匹配。这种方法比暴力破解法快,但前提是密码在常用列表中。
- 下载并安装密码恢复工具,例如PassFab for Excel。
- 运行软件并导入受保护的Excel文件。
- 选择“字典攻击”选项,并导入常用密码列表。
- 开始破解过程,等待软件找到密码。
1.3 掩码攻击法
掩码攻击法使用已知的密码结构信息进行匹配。例如,如果你记得密码的部分内容或特定字符,可以使用这种方法来缩小搜索范围。
- 下载并安装密码恢复工具,例如PassFab for Excel。
- 运行软件并导入受保护的Excel文件。
- 选择“掩码攻击”选项,并设置已知的密码结构信息。
- 开始破解过程,等待软件找到密码。
二、尝试旧密码
有时候,我们可能会忘记最新的密码,但还记得之前使用过的旧密码。尝试回忆并输入之前使用过的密码,可能会帮助你找到正确的密码。
2.1 检查记录
如果你有记录密码的习惯,可以查看以前的记录,看看是否有相关的密码信息。保持良好的记录习惯,可以有效避免忘记密码的困扰。
2.2 尝试常用密码组合
如果你没有记录密码的习惯,可以尝试一些常用的密码组合。很多人会使用相似的密码格式或组合,例如生日、电话号码等。尝试这些常用组合,可能会帮助你找到正确的密码。
三、联系IT支持
如果你在工作环境中使用Excel文件,并且忘记了密码,可以联系公司的IT支持部门。他们通常有专业的工具和方法来帮助你恢复文件访问。
3.1 提供必要信息
联系IT支持时,提供尽可能多的信息,例如文件名、创建时间、可能的密码组合等。这些信息可以帮助IT支持更快地找到解决方案。
3.2 遵循公司政策
在公司环境中,遵循公司的安全政策和流程非常重要。IT支持部门通常会有严格的规定和流程来确保文件安全和数据保护。遵循这些规定,可以确保你的文件安全性。
四、使用备份文件
如果你有备份文件,可以恢复到之前的版本。虽然这可能会导致一些数据丢失,但至少可以恢复大部分内容。
4.1 查找备份文件
检查你是否有最近的备份文件。很多人会定期备份重要文件,以防止数据丢失。如果有备份文件,可以直接使用备份文件。
4.2 恢复备份文件
将备份文件复制到原文件位置,并重命名为原文件名。打开备份文件,检查数据是否完整。如果有部分数据丢失,可以手动恢复这些数据。
五、重置工作表密码
如果你无法找到文件密码,可以尝试重置工作表密码。这种方法需要一些技术知识,但可以帮助你重新访问文件。
5.1 使用VBA代码
VBA(Visual Basic for Applications)是Excel内置的编程语言,可以用来编写代码破解工作表密码。以下是一个简单的VBA代码示例:
Sub PasswordBreaker()
Dim i As Integer, j As Integer, k As Integer
Dim l As Integer, m As Integer, n As Integer
Dim i1 As Integer, i2 As Integer, i3 As Integer
Dim i4 As Integer, i5 As Integer, i6 As Integer
On Error Resume Next
For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
For l = 65 To 66: For m = 65 To 66: For n = 65 To 66
For i1 = 65 To 66: For i2 = 65 To 66: For i3 = 65 To 66
For i4 = 65 To 66: For i5 = 65 To 66: For i6 = 65 To 66
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_
Chr(l) & Chr(m) & Chr(n) & Chr(i1) & Chr(i2) & _
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6)
If ActiveSheet.ProtectContents = False Then
MsgBox "Password is " & Chr(i) & Chr(j) & Chr(k) & _
Chr(l) & Chr(m) & Chr(n) & Chr(i1) & Chr(i2) & _
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6)
Exit Sub
End If
Next: Next: Next: Next: Next: Next
Next: Next: Next: Next: Next: Next
Next: Next: Next
End Sub
将上述代码复制到VBA编辑器中,并运行代码。代码会尝试破解工作表密码,并显示密码。
5.2 使用第三方工具
如果你不熟悉VBA代码,可以使用第三方工具来重置工作表密码。例如,PassFab for Excel、Excel Password Recovery Lastic等工具可以帮助你重置工作表密码。
六、预防措施
为了避免将来再次遇到忘记密码的问题,可以采取一些预防措施。例如,使用密码管理器、定期备份文件、设置密码提示等。
6.1 使用密码管理器
密码管理器可以帮助你安全地存储和管理所有密码。使用密码管理器,可以避免忘记密码的困扰,并确保密码的安全性。
6.2 定期备份文件
定期备份重要文件,可以有效防止数据丢失。即使忘记密码,也可以使用备份文件恢复数据。
6.3 设置密码提示
在设置密码时,可以设置密码提示。密码提示可以帮助你回忆密码,但不要使用过于明显的提示,以免被他人猜到。
七、总结
忘记Excel PIN密码可能会导致数据无法访问,但通过使用密码恢复工具、尝试旧密码、联系IT支持、使用备份文件和重置工作表密码等方法,可以有效解决这一问题。同时,采取预防措施,如使用密码管理器、定期备份文件和设置密码提示,可以避免将来再次遇到忘记密码的问题。
在面对密码问题时,保持冷静和耐心,逐步尝试不同的方法,通常可以找到解决方案。通过不断学习和积累经验,可以提高处理类似问题的能力,确保数据的安全性和可访问性。
相关问答FAQs:
1. 如何找回我在Excel中设置的PIN密码?
- 首先,打开Excel文件并点击“文件”选项卡。
- 其次,选择“保护工作簿”下的“加密工作簿”。
- 接下来,点击“忘记密码?”链接。
- 在弹出的对话框中,输入您记得的密码提示信息。
- 如果输入的密码提示信息正确,Excel将显示您设置的PIN密码。
2. 我忘记了在Excel中设置的PIN密码,有没有其他的解决方法?
- 是的,您可以尝试使用VBA宏代码来破解密码。
- 首先,按下“Alt + F11”打开VBA编辑器。
- 其次,选择“插入”选项卡,然后选择“模块”。
- 将以下代码复制粘贴到新模块中:
Sub PasswordBreaker()
Dim i As Integer, j As Integer, k As Integer
Dim l As Integer, m As Integer, n As Integer
Dim i1 As Integer, i2 As Integer, i3 As Integer
Dim i4 As Integer, i5 As Integer, i6 As Integer
On Error Resume Next
For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
For l = 65 To 66: For m = 65 To 66: For i1 = 65 To 66
For i2 = 65 To 66: For i3 = 65 To 66: For i4 = 65 To 66
For i5 = 65 To 66: For i6 = 65 To 66: For n = 32 To 126
ActiveSheet.Unprotect Chr(i) & Chr(j) & Chr(k) & _
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
If ActiveSheet.ProtectContents = False Then
MsgBox "密码已破解:" & Chr(i) & Chr(j) & _
Chr(k) & Chr(l) & Chr(m) & Chr(i1) & _
Chr(i2) & Chr(i3) & Chr(i4) & Chr(i5) & _
Chr(i6) & Chr(n)
Exit Sub
End If
Next: Next: Next: Next: Next: Next
Next: Next: Next: Next: Next: Next
End Sub
- 最后,按下“F5”运行宏代码,等待密码破解。
3. 我忘记了Excel中设置的PIN密码,还有其他方法可以恢复访问吗?
- 是的,您可以尝试使用第三方密码恢复软件来破解Excel的PIN密码。
- 首先,下载并安装一个可靠的Excel密码恢复软件,如PassFab for Excel。
- 其次,打开软件并导入被锁定的Excel文件。
- 接下来,选择恢复模式(如暴力破解、字典攻击等)并开始恢复过程。
- 软件将尝试不同的密码组合,直到找到正确的PIN密码。
- 最后,一旦找到密码,软件将显示在屏幕上,您可以使用该密码解锁Excel文件。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4804375